What Is Medical Coding Software?

Medical coding software is a digital platform that helps healthcare organizations turn patient care into standardized billing codes quickly and accurately.
It reads clinical documentation, suggests the right codes, checks them against payer rules, and flags errors before a claim is submitted. The goal is simple: fewer mistakes, faster payments, and less manual work.
You’ll often hear two terms that get mixed up:
- Medical encoder software is a reference tool. It helps a human coder look up and confirm the correct ICD-10, CPT, or HCPCS code.
- Computer-assisted coding (CAC) software goes further. It uses natural language processing (NLP) to read clinical notes and suggest codes automatically, which the coder then reviews.
Think of an encoder as a smart dictionary and CAC as a smart assistant. Both speed up the work, but CAC does more of the heavy lifting.
How Does Medical Coding Software Work?
Most modern platforms follow the same core workflow. Here’s what happens behind the scenes:
- Ingests clinical documentation from your electronic health record (EHR), including physician notes, lab results, and procedure reports.
- Analyzes the notes using NLP and AI to understand diagnoses, treatments, and procedures.
- Suggests codes ICD-10 for diagnoses, CPT and HCPCS for procedures and services.
- Runs compliance and modifier checks to confirm codes match payer and federal rules.
- Scrubs the claim for missing data or errors before it goes out the door.
- Generates audit trails and analytics so managers can track accuracy, denials, and revenue trends.
The result? A coder who used to spend hours hunting for codes can now review AI suggestions in a fraction of the time. This efficiency is what powers a clean claims submission process.
Why Healthcare Providers Need Medical Coding Software
Manual coding is slow, error-prone, and expensive. Here’s what the right software actually fixes.
Fewer Claim Denials
Most denials trace back to coding errors, missing modifiers, or documentation gaps. Coding software catches these issues before submission, which lifts your first-pass acceptance rate and keeps revenue flowing.
Faster Reimbursement
Clean claims get paid faster. By automating code selection and scrubbing, software shortens the time between patient care and payment a lifeline for practices managing tight cash flow.
Stronger HIPAA Compliance
Payer rules and coding standards change constantly. Quality software updates automatically with ICD, CPT, and HCPCS changes, and it protects patient data with encryption and access controls to stay HIPAA-compliant.
Better Staff Productivity
When repetitive lookups disappear, your coders can focus on complex cases instead of routine entries. That means fewer bottlenecks, less burnout, and happier staff.
How to Choose Medical Coding Software (Step-by-Step)

Picking the right tool isn’t about chasing the flashiest features. It’s about matching the software to your organization. Follow these six steps.
Step 1: Map Your Provider Type and Specialty
A solo dermatology practice and a 500-bed hospital have very different needs. Start by listing your specialties, claim volume, and care settings (inpatient, outpatient, or both).
Step 2: Check EHR and Billing System Integration
Your coding software should plug directly into your existing EHR and billing platform. Strong integration kills duplicate data entry and reduces errors. If a tool doesn’t connect to your Epic, Oracle Health, or MEDITECH system, keep looking.
Step 3: Evaluate AI and Automation Capabilities
Ask vendors how their AI suggests codes and how often it’s right. Look for NLP-driven suggestions, modifier recommendations, and claim scrubbing built in.
Step 4: Confirm HIPAA Compliance and Security
Any platform handling patient data must be HIPAA-compliant. Confirm it offers encryption, role-based access controls, and detailed audit logs.
Step 5: Compare Total Cost of Ownership
Look beyond the license fee. Factor in implementation, training, and maintenance. A cheaper tool that takes months to set up can cost more in the long run. Step 6: Test Vendor Support and Scalability
Pick a vendor that responds fast and a platform that grows with you. If you plan to add locations or specialties, make sure the software can scale without a painful migration later.

Medical Coding Software vs Medical Billing Software

People often use these terms interchangeably, but they do different jobs.
| Medical Coding Software | Medical Billing Software |
| Translates clinical care into ICD, CPT, and HCPCS codes | Uses those codes to create and submit claims |
| Focuses on accuracy and compliance | Focuses on payment and collections |
| Helps coders and HIM teams | Helps billers and the front office |
| Reduces coding errors and denials | Manages invoices, payments, and follow-ups |
In short: coding software gets the codes right, and billing software gets you paid. Many platforms like Aptarro and AdvancedMD combine both into one revenue cycle system, which simplifies your workflow.
How Medical Coding Software Reduces Claim Denials
Denials usually come from a handful of preventable problems. Coding software tackles each one.
When a code doesn’t match the documentation, the software flags it. When a modifier is missing, it suggests one. When a claim has incomplete data, the scrubbing tool catches it before submission.
That chain of checks adds up. Each error you catch upstream is one less denial, one less appeal, and one less delay in getting paid.
Common denial causes that software prevents:
- Mismatched ICD-10 and CPT codes
- Missing or incorrect modifiers
- Documentation that doesn’t support the code
- Outdated codes after a regulatory change
Clinical Documentation Improvement (CDI)
Even the best software can’t code what isn’t documented. That’s where clinical documentation improvement comes in.
CDI programs make sure physician notes capture the full clinical picture. When documentation is clear and complete, coding software has better raw material to work with and your denial rate drops. Pairing strong CDI with coding software is one of the most effective ways to protect revenue.
AI and Autonomous Coding: Where the Industry Is Headed
AI coding is having a real moment, as the Healthcare Financial Management Association (HFMA) has noted. But there’s an important distinction buyers need to understand.
Computer-assisted coding (CAC) suggests codes that a human coder reviews and approves. The human stays in the loop on every chart.
Autonomous coding goes a step further. It uses AI to read documentation, apply coding rules, and submit claims without human review but only on confident, straightforward cases. Complex charts still route to a coder. That’s the “human-in-the-loop” model most vendors use today.
So how accurate is it? Accuracy varies by vendor and specialty, and the strongest results tend to appear in high-volume, repetitive case types like radiology. The honest answer: AI handles routine coding well, but it doesn’t replace expert coders for nuanced cases at least not yet.
Is AI coding software HIPAA-compliant? It can be, and reputable vendors build to that standard. Look for encryption, access controls, audit trails, and regular bias audits. HIM teams should still review autonomous systems regularly to confirm accuracy and catch drift.
The bottom line on ROI: autonomous coding can cut costs and speed up reimbursement when it fits your case mix. Start with a pilot, measure accuracy against your coders, and expand from there.

How much does medical coding software cost?
Costs vary widely by practice size and features. Entry-level AI coding tools for small practices often start around $500 to $1,000 per month, while enterprise platforms cost significantly more. Always factor in implementation, training, and maintenance on top of licensing.
Is AI medical coding software HIPAA compliant?
It can be. Reputable AI coding platforms are built to meet HIPAA standards with encryption, access controls, and audit logs. Always confirm a vendor’s compliance certifications and ask how they protect patient data before you buy.
What’s the difference between CAC and encoder software?
An encoder is a reference tool that helps a human coder look up the correct code. Computer-assisted coding (CAC) goes further, using NLP to read clinical notes and suggest codes automatically for the coder to review.
